Preparation and crystal structures of [PPh4]2[M2(SPh)6](M = Zn or Cd)
Abstract
The compounds [PPh4]2[Zn2(SPh)6] and [PPh4]2[Cd2(SPh)6] have been prepared by reaction between the hydrated metal(II) nitrate and [PPh4][SPh] in methanol–acetonitrile solution. The compounds are isostructural (space group P21/c) and the dimeric anion has crystallographic inversion symmetry, imposing an anti arrangement of the two bridging benzenethiolate ligands. The metal atoms have a distorted tetrahedral co-ordination with two terminal and two bridging ligands. The central M2S2 rings are exactly planar and essentially square [Zn–S 2.424(1), 2.431(1)Å, S–Zn–S 90.7(1)°; Cd–S 2.611(1), 2.611(1)Å S–Cd–S = 91.8(1)°]. Proton and 13C n.m.r. spectra indicate a rapid exchange of terminal and bridging ligands of the anions in solution.
